Use OCCT Handle macro for Handle_ classes
This is the result of running OCCT's upgrade script provided with OCCT 7.0. See https://www.opencascade.com/content/freecad-occt710-and-windows-rtti-data-missing#comment-form and https://www.forum.freecadweb.org/viewtopic.php?f=4&t=21405&start=120#p169019 for why this is necessary for OCCT >= 7.1
